Rare opportunity! Recently refurbished pub in a town-centre location available for lease.

Trading Area & Facilities

Internally the pub has a front area with vertical drinking and higher seating for those that want to meet and drink with friends whilst the rear section has boothed seating and a more relaxed dining style feel. There is a new catering kitchen, to allow the introduction of a simple, fast-paced food offer. To the rear, the outside trading area has a mix of seating and floor finishes, it stands out as a great outdoor area and is visible to passing footfall. There is a covered area, with decked flooring, fixed seating and decorative bric-a-brac, to allow customers to enjoy the outside offer throughout the year.

Fantastic location

The Crafty Two will play a pivotal role in the master plan to revamp this part of Tamworth's town centre. Nearby investments include the £6.2m refurbishments of the local assembly rooms across the road, the creation of a new restaurant and enhancements to the public highway/footpaths. It is also very close to the drop off point for several public transport routes for the town. There is a considerable amount of regeneration happening within the area, meaning the pub is a prime location. Star Pubs and Bars recently completed an extensive refurbishment here and created a stand out pub with a strong focus on craft ales. With its rustic appeal, it has the fantastic opportunity to attract new customers and create something unique to the local area. The introduction of a quality and varied food and coffee offer, combined with a fantastic outside area will ensure the pub attracts a wealth of new customers.

Private Accommodation

The private accommodation consists of three bedrooms, kitchen & bathroom and a lounge. In line with our Ready to Trade Promise, we will ensure the private accommodation is in good condition, so that you can focus on your business.
